Job Description
Responsible To:
Director of Maintenance and Superintendent Salary:
Base on experienceQualifications:
Postsecondary degree or certification preferred, not required At least five (5) years experience in the field of maintenance Valid Kansas driver's license is requiredEssential Functions:
Work is performed while standing, sitting and/or walking Requires the ability to communicate effectively using speech, vision, and hearing Requires the use of hands for simple grasping and fine manipulations Requires bending, squatting, crawling, climbing, reaching Requires the ability to lift, carry, push or pull 50 lbs or more Requires basic computer skillsGeneral Responsibilities:
Identifies current and future maintenance requirements at schools and support buildings by coordinating with administrators, local/state/federal staff, tradesmen, technicians, vendors, and other persons in a position to understand maintenance requirements. Identifies requirements for annual maintenance projects, preparing recommendations for capital and renovation improvements, coordinating projects and bids with the purchasing office, analyzing variance, initiating corrective action, and anticipating long-term issues. Ensures proper environment and continuous improvement for the educational process by determining work priorities, by scheduling repairs, maintenance and installation of machines, tools, equipment, and systems. Priority of work is based on facility need, the age of facilities and components, and the order in which work requests are received. Supports educational environmental development and improvements by reviewing new products, equipment, systems, and by discussing equipment and systems needs and modifications with engineers and vendors, coordinating activities of technicians, workers and contractors fabricating or modifying structures, equipment or systems. Provides water, heat, electric distribution, gas, sewage removal and conditioned air directing installation or modifications to and maintenance on utility systems building components. Designs, implements and modifies preventive maintenance programs by reviewing maintenance reports and statistics, by reviewing quality control reports, and inspecting operating machines, equipment and systems for conformance with operational standards (Includes fire, HVAC, structural, electrical, mechanical, security, and other systems). Directs maintenance operations by identifying requirements, forecasting resources, providing oversight for minor construction projects, capital improvement projects, and daily repair tasks. Assure timely completion of all tasks by providing direction to supervisors, technicians, engineers, and vendors. Protects district staff and visitors by maintaining a safe, and equitable educational environment. Prepares and approves specifications for contracted purchase of replacement parts and new equipment and systems for all areas of the school district. Maintains maintenance staff job results by coaching, counseling, and disciplining employees and by planning, monitoring and appraising job results. Assures the training, annual evaluation, and discipline of sixty-six maintenance employees. Complies with federal, state and local legal requirements by studying existing and new legislation, by enforcing adherence to requirements, and by advising administration on needed actions. Oversees capital improvement and renovation projects; reviews project specifications; analyzes design, district requirements and performance standards; ensures district goals are met by performing preliminary and final "punch lists" for construction projects. Maintains professional and technical knowledge by attending educational workshops, reviewing professional publications, and establishing personal networks. Recruits and hires the maintenance, grounds, and custodial staff. Maintains regular attendance. Performs other duties as assigned by the Director Of Maintenance and theSuperintendent Evaluation:
Performance of this job will be evaluated annually in accordance with provisions of the Board's policy on Evaluation of Nonprofessional Personnel. Assistant Director Of Maintenance St.Marys Saint Marys, KS Full-time Full-time Responsible To:
